Babson Slips Past Baseball, 6-3, in NEWMAC Play

Box Score

Babson Park, Mass. - April 10, 2018 - Despite senior Mark Joao (Wappingers Falls, N.Y.) and sophomore Jake Gleason (South Dennis, Mass.) both registering home runs in the contest, the Springfield College baseball team fell to Babson, 6-3, in New England Women's and Men's Athletic Conference (NEWMAC) play on Tuesday afternoon at Giovoni Field. 

With the loss, the Pride saw its four-game win streak come to a halt, as the Pride is now 17-6-2 with a 6-3 record against conference opponents. Babson improved to 18-7 overall and 8-2 in NEWMAC play with the win.

Joao finished the day 1-for-4 at the plate with two RBI, while Brandon Drabinski (Lisbon, Conn.) and Chad Shade (Pittsfield, Mass.) both had two hits apiece. Senior Joe Gamache (Lebanon, Conn.) got the nod for the Pride and pitched 3.2 innings, giving up nine hits, while Ken Manero (Hudson, Mass.) came on in relief and held the Beavers to just two hits across 2.0 innings. Jack Weinberger (Sunapee, N.H.) came on for the final 2.1 frames and held Babson to just one hit while striking out a pair.

Babson's Michael Genaro (Greenwich, Conn.) improved to 5-1 as he pitched 7.0 innings and struck out nine, while Matt Cuneo (Ashland, Mass.) picked up his third save of the year.

Springfield College jumped out to an early 2-0 lead over the Beavers in the top of the first when Shade reached on a single to lead off the game, before two batters later, Joao cracked his third home run of the year to left field. Babson would cut its deficit to one on a sacrifice fly that scored David Lennon (Windermere, Fla.), before Gleason pushed the Pride's advantage back to a pair with a solo shot to right field, making it 3-1, Springfield.

In the bottom of the second, Babson rallied for three runs to take a 4-3 advantage, before Genaro settled in, picking up six strikeouts through the rest of his outing. The Beavers would add insurance runs in the bottom of the fourth and bottom of the sixth to seal the win.

Springfield College will return to action on Thursday, April 12 when the Pride heads to Keene State for a non-conference game beginning at 3:30 p.m.
